gpu显卡时序问题怎么解决gpu显卡时序问题
深度学习
2024-05-14 21:30
1010
联系人:
联系方式:
GPU显卡时序问题:挑战与解决方案
随着计算机图形技术的不断发展,GPU(图形处理器)在现代计算中扮演着越来越重要的角色。然而,随着GPU性能的不断提升,其内部复杂的时序问题也逐渐暴露出来,成为影响GPU性能和稳定性的重要因素。本文将探讨GPU显卡时序问题的挑战以及可能的解决方案。
一、GPU显卡时序问题的挑战
- 并行处理与时序同步
GPU的核心优势在于其强大的并行处理能力,可以同时执行大量的计算任务。然而,这种并行性也给时序控制带来了挑战。不同的计算任务需要在正确的时间点协同工作,以确保图像渲染的正确性和流畅性。如果时序控制不当,可能会导致画面撕裂、卡顿等问题。
- 高速缓存与时序一致性
GPU内部通常包含多层高速缓存,用于提高数据访问速度。然而,在高速缓存中保持数据的一致性是一个挑战。当多个计算单元同时访问同一块数据时,需要确保它们看到的是相同的数据版本,否则可能导致计算结果错误。
- 驱动程序与时序优化
GPU的性能不仅取决于硬件本身,还受到驱动程序的影响。驱动程序负责协调GPU内部的各个组件,确保它们按照正确的时序工作。然而,编写高效的驱动程序并非易事,需要对GPU架构有深入的理解,并进行大量的时序优化。
二、GPU显卡时序问题的解决方案
- 引入时间戳机制
为了精确控制GPU内部的时序,可以引入时间戳机制。每个计算任务在执行前都会获取一个时间戳,表示该任务的开始时间。通过比较不同任务的时间戳,可以确定它们的执行顺序,从而避免时序冲突。
- 采用锁步执行策略
锁步执行是一种常见的时序同步方法,它要求两个或更多的计算单元在同一时刻开始执行相同的指令。这样可以确保所有计算单元在任何时候都看到相同的数据状态,从而保证时序一致性。
- 优化驱动程序设计
为了提高驱动程序的效率,可以从以下几个方面进行优化:对驱动程序进行模块化设计,使其能够适应不同类型的GPU架构;其次,利用现代编译器技术对驱动程序进行自动优化,以提高代码的执行效率;定期对驱动程序进行更新和维护,以适应不断变化的硬件和软件环境。
- 利用人工智能技术辅助调试
随着人工智能技术的发展,可以利用机器学习等方法来辅助GPU显卡的时序调试。通过对大量运行数据进行训练和分析,AI模型可以自动识别出潜在的时序问题并提出相应的优化建议。这将大大提高调试效率并降低人工成本。
GPU显卡的时序问题是影响其性能和稳定性的关键因素之一。为了解决这一问题,需要从硬件设计、驱动程序优化等多个方面进行综合考虑并采取相应的措施。随着技术的不断进步和创新思维的不断涌现相信未来会有更多有效的解决方案出现为计算机图形领域带来更大的突破和发展空间。
GPU显卡时序问题:挑战与解决方案
随着计算机图形技术的不断发展,GPU(图形处理器)在现代计算中扮演着越来越重要的角色。然而,随着GPU性能的不断提升,其内部复杂的时序问题也逐渐暴露出来,成为影响GPU性能和稳定性的重要因素。本文将探讨GPU显卡时序问题的挑战以及可能的解决方案。
一、GPU显卡时序问题的挑战
- 并行处理与时序同步
GPU的核心优势在于其强大的并行处理能力,可以同时执行大量的计算任务。然而,这种并行性也给时序控制带来了挑战。不同的计算任务需要在正确的时间点协同工作,以确保图像渲染的正确性和流畅性。如果时序控制不当,可能会导致画面撕裂、卡顿等问题。
- 高速缓存与时序一致性
GPU内部通常包含多层高速缓存,用于提高数据访问速度。然而,在高速缓存中保持数据的一致性是一个挑战。当多个计算单元同时访问同一块数据时,需要确保它们看到的是相同的数据版本,否则可能导致计算结果错误。
- 驱动程序与时序优化
GPU的性能不仅取决于硬件本身,还受到驱动程序的影响。驱动程序负责协调GPU内部的各个组件,确保它们按照正确的时序工作。然而,编写高效的驱动程序并非易事,需要对GPU架构有深入的理解,并进行大量的时序优化。
二、GPU显卡时序问题的解决方案
- 引入时间戳机制
为了精确控制GPU内部的时序,可以引入时间戳机制。每个计算任务在执行前都会获取一个时间戳,表示该任务的开始时间。通过比较不同任务的时间戳,可以确定它们的执行顺序,从而避免时序冲突。
- 采用锁步执行策略
锁步执行是一种常见的时序同步方法,它要求两个或更多的计算单元在同一时刻开始执行相同的指令。这样可以确保所有计算单元在任何时候都看到相同的数据状态,从而保证时序一致性。
- 优化驱动程序设计
为了提高驱动程序的效率,可以从以下几个方面进行优化:对驱动程序进行模块化设计,使其能够适应不同类型的GPU架构;其次,利用现代编译器技术对驱动程序进行自动优化,以提高代码的执行效率;定期对驱动程序进行更新和维护,以适应不断变化的硬件和软件环境。
- 利用人工智能技术辅助调试
随着人工智能技术的发展,可以利用机器学习等方法来辅助GPU显卡的时序调试。通过对大量运行数据进行训练和分析,AI模型可以自动识别出潜在的时序问题并提出相应的优化建议。这将大大提高调试效率并降低人工成本。
GPU显卡的时序问题是影响其性能和稳定性的关键因素之一。为了解决这一问题,需要从硬件设计、驱动程序优化等多个方面进行综合考虑并采取相应的措施。随着技术的不断进步和创新思维的不断涌现相信未来会有更多有效的解决方案出现为计算机图形领域带来更大的突破和发展空间。